Transaction 327aaabcd6ff21289c4158949ca46cb111b11e7956a4223590dafe707269bf5f
1 Input
-
795f6cbe8dd7f2455de96159e49c4d594242cf2d0df76857d339fbb2c2f21165:1
OP_DATA_48(48) 45022100bd340b8379da5206a35bff944944a0a72a87a73d9072cca52312b4c265d3f621022030b2f6ae5c638bc53ad4OP_PUBKEY(254)
1 Outputs
- 327aaabcd6ff21289c4158949ca46cb111b11e7956a4223590dafe707269bf5f:0
value 40351364
address 3LFy7weQRoTLbx5C5ajXdy6ADJNTUXheyA